ACCA seems not to be awarding any part marks for section A on the objective questions if yu get one correct wre they award 2 marks and wanting 2 answers. they just mark yu wrong without awarding that one mark. Is this true sir.
This question is from the English F4 specimen exam:
‘In the context of the law of contract, which TWO of the following statements in relation to a letter of comfort are correct?
(1) It is a binding promise to pay a subsidiary company’s future debts
(2) It is a non-binding statement of present intention to pay a subsidiary company’s future debts
(3) It is issued by a parent company
(4) It is issued by a parent company’s bank
A 1 and 3
B 2 and 3
C 2 and 4
D 1 and 2″
The answer here is option B, selecting statements 2 and 3 as being correct
You’re asking whether, if you choose say option A selecting statements 1 and 3 as being correct, you will be awarded 1 mark out of the 2 available because you selected statement 3 correctly
No, sorry. It’s all or nothing in these multiple choice questions
